Emollient laxatives like mineral oil and stimulant laxatives like castor oil must be avoided during pregnancy due to their potential for maternal and fetal morbidity (4). Stimulant laxatives such as bisacodyl, senna, and cascara have the fastest onset of action, but are associated with hypokalemia (low potassium levels), hyponatremia (low sodium levels), and colic.5 There are some medications more recently approved to manage chronic constipation but they are unlikely to be prescribed during pregnancy.
